Slack came in as yet another “email killer”. It isn’t. It just adds yet another channel I have to watch. Or, of course, lots of channels. It really provides nothing that usenet readers don’t already do, except a sexier interface. It only added threading earlier this year and boy did it seem as if they had split the atom the noise that was made. So now I have to monitor email, our existing instant messaging system (which can also do pretty much everything Slack does, but isn’t as sexy), Slack, internal forums, …, …, …
